Market Commentary
The recent plunge in Bitcoin's price has had a ripple effect on the cryptocurrency market, including Dogecoin. Bitcoin's decline has sparked concerns about further downward pressure on the price of altcoins like DOGE.
Analysts are divided on the future of DOGE in the wake of this downturn. Some believe that the coin's close association with Elon Musk, who has tweeted support for DOGE in the past, could provide some support against the bearish trend.
However, others argue that DOGE lacks fundamental value and may continue to suffer from volatility as long as its price remains largely driven by sentiment and momentum.
